Major NBA Star Won’t Play in 2023 Basketball World Cup

One of the main stars of the NBA in recent years needs surgery and is out of the Basketball World Cup, which starts this Friday, 25

One hell of a drop! The orange ball player Gianni Antetokounmpo will not be on the list Greece to the world Cup2023 Basketball Championship. The athlete of Milwaukee Bucks had to undergo surgery on his left knee, unable to get medical clearance to compete at the Worlds, which starts this coming Friday, the 25th.

Through his social networks, Giannis made it clear that it was not a personal choice, but that the absence of the courts during the competition was his “only option”. In addition, the Greek said in a statement that he was saddened by the departure from the national team. Antetokounmpo also stated that his biggest career goal at the moment is for Greece to qualify for the Paris 2024 Olympic Games.

“It wasn’t a choice but my only option. I am extremely disappointed about this but it was a decision made by my doctors. I will continue to push myself and be ready for the next time my name is called out. My personal goal, and the team too, is qualifying for the 2024 Olympics and having the honor of representing my country’s national team next year”he said.

Even with the absence of the star player, the Greece will be attended by two brothers from Giannis, the players Kostas It is Thanassiswho also work for NBA. The selection of the three faces the U.SThe Jordan and the New Zealand in the group stage. A world Cup gives seven direct seats to Olympic Gamesbeing the two best placed of the Americasthe two best Europethe best of Africa, Asia It is Oceania.
